Bug 322381

Summary: Join -sysv packages to clamav-server and clamav-milter
Product: [Fedora] Fedora Reporter: Milan Kerslager <milan.kerslager>
Component: clamavAssignee: Enrico Scholz <rh-bugzilla>
Status: CLOSED WONTFIX Q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: low Docs Contact:
Priority: low    
Version: rawhideCC: rpm
Target Milestone: ---Keywords: Reopened
Target Release: ---   
Hardware: All   
OS: Linux   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2007-10-08 06:46:11 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Attachments:
Description Flags
Join <main>-sysv packages with main packages
none
Join <main>-sysv packages with main packages none

Description Milan Kerslager 2007-10-07 17:42:48 UTC
There is no reason to have separate package for sysv scripts
(clamav-server-sysv, clamav-milter-sysv) execept generic package for both BSD
and SYSV style distributions. Since Fedora has SYSV initscripts, no other daemon
has separate package for sysv init script and *-sysv packages are always
installed along with (clamav-server and clamav-milter), please join sysv
packages to their master packages.

This will simplify clamav use and install.

Comment 1 Milan Kerslager 2007-10-07 17:48:22 UTC
Created attachment 218801 [details]
Join <main>-sysv packages with main packages

Comment 2 Milan Kerslager 2007-10-07 17:59:42 UTC
Created attachment 218821 [details]
Join <main>-sysv packages with main packages

Sorry. There was a little bug.

Comment 3 Enrico Scholz 2007-10-07 19:28:51 UTC
Unless the dep-bloat in initscripts (e.g. splitting /etc/init.d/functions and
hardware related parts) gets fixed (where I do not have any hope about), I am
going to close this as WONTFIX.

Comment 4 Milan Kerslager 2007-10-07 21:30:36 UTC
I don't underestand.

Whole distribution does not split init script from daemons. Please follow
package guedelines.

Comment 5 Enrico Scholz 2007-10-07 22:19:23 UTC
1. there is no such packaging guideline which requires the requested change
2. packaging guidelines are interesting for new packages only

Comment 6 Milan Kerslager 2007-10-08 00:35:11 UTC
Splitting /etc/init.d/functions is not a job for ClamAV package.
ClamAV package has nothing to do with hardware.
All packages in Fedora (ie "normal one") has sysv init script packaged inside.
ClamAV is really new package in Fedora (FC7).
There is no reason to do thing the hard and overcomplex way.

So please, please, make your package simple and do not stay oposite when someone
is asking do make a better package.